Langtang Ganja La pass trekking
is situated south of the Tibetan border. It is inhabited
by Sherpa and Tamangs, who share a similar religion, language
and clothing style. Langtang Valley trek offers an opportunity
to explore Tibetan villages, Tamang Villages, small various
peaks and to visit glaciers and as green forest with blooming
national flowers Rhododendrons. Kyanjin Gompa is a last
Tibetan Village in the valley, from where a trek starts
to Helambu over Ganja La Pass (5200M). The pass it self
is not easy, during autumn and spring the pass opens for
trekkers. A trek Over Ganja la pass offers an entirely
wilderness and adventure experience. So, local inquiries
about its condition, good equipment and mountaineering
experience are necessary for safe crossing. The Helambu
village excludes a Tibetan feel and you will see fields
enclosed by stonewall as well as herds of yaks, the most
important animal for the people here. From Tarke Gyang,
we descend to Melamchi Khola before hiking to Pati Bhyanjyang,
then trek down to Sundarijal; from here, we drive back
to Kathmandu. |
